While Western Classical music remains an integral part of Mumbai's performing arts calendar, piano recitals are witnessing increasing adulation from music aficionados, resulting in a rise in the number of live performances by Indian and international artists. Ruchika Kher explores the key behind this trend
“The piano keys are black and white, but they sound like a million colours in your mind”, is how short story writer Maria Cristina Mena described the power of the piano. This adage might hold true for Mumbai audiences who seem to have fallen in love with the piano keys. In the last couple of months, the number of piano performances in the city is testament to this trend, perhaps.
